Hi @katteasis ! Thanks for replying! I honestly still am confused however. :( It is my understanding that we should never share our private keys anywhere, ever, and I get why that is important. But, it is the PRIVATE posting key that is needed to sign into mspsteem. I don't see how using one of my private keys to sign in could be more secure than using my master password. Maybe I am still missing something? I would really like to understand the logic here. If you can point me to somewhere that explains, I would be very appreciative!

Your master password is the main key for your account. If anything happens to it then you may not get your account back. Posting key gives posting authorization only(like post,comment,vote), and can't be used for fund transfer,so your funds are safe anyway. However using master key gives all the access, if a hacker get that then..?
